MANILA, Philippines — President Ferdinand Marcos Jr. has accepted the resignation of Manuel Bonoan as secretary of the Department of Public Works and Highways (DPWH), Malacañang said on Sunday.

Bonoan’s resignation takes effect on Monday, September 1. He will be replaced by Transportation Secretary Vivencio “Vince” Dizon, according to the Presidential Communications Office (PCO).
